The ReadCOMPOSED FROM THE MEASURES BELOW
Nothing separates the early types on measured speed — expect a fight for the front. Winners here typically raced recently (88% within 45 days) and were prominent in the betting (82% from the first three favourites); the typical winner also sits around 3rd at halfway before quickening late, having spent about 48% of its energy before the final two furlongs. On the measured reads, SISTERANDBROTHER leads on 72, 0pts clear of AL MASLOOL and MR MOONSHINE (IRE) (both 72) — flagged on our watch list. The case against the top pick: stepping up into much stronger company on the ratings and habitually slow from the stalls. The shape danger is AL MASLOOL — the strongest late speed in this field, races handy on energy — profits if the early types overdo it. The market sees it differently, making AL MASLOOL the 30% favourite — a horse our figures rate 2nd.

What this course & distance favours
Won by front-runners 38% · prominent racers 33% (24 past C&D winners · won up with the pace). Flat, very short (~240y) — favours horses already on/near the pace finish.
